Which sample of ethanol has particles with the highest average kinetic energy?
(1) 10.0 mL of ethanol at 25°C
(2) 10.0 mL of ethanol at 55°C
(3) 100.0 mL of ethanol at 35°C
(4) 100.0 mL of ethanol at 45°C

Respuesta :

the answer is two. All you are looking for with highest average kinetic energy is the one with the highest temperature. In this case it is 10mL ethanol at 55 degrees Celsius.
The second one.
Remember, temperature is the AVERAGE kinetic energy. So, looking for highest average kinetic energy means looking for highest temperature, which is 55.
Note: the amount of the substance does not determine the average kinetic energy.
